Softening Butter

Effective techniques for softening butter.

Softening Butter at Room Temperature

Take the butter out of the refrigerator and leave at room temperature for about 30-60 minutes before you plan to use it. For faster softening, cut the butter into small pieces. You can also decrease softening times by beating the butter with an electric mixer or by placing it between two sheets of waxed or parchment paper and pounding it with a rolling pin.

Softening Butter in the Microwave

Microwave 1 stick of butter for about 30 seconds on High or 60-90 seconds on Low. Check the butter every 10 to 15 seconds, as it is easy to inadvertently melt the butter. In the event that you do melt it, the butter it will not be suitable for baking. Instead, use it for other cooking and sautéing applications that call for melted butter.

Softening Butter with Steam

Place butter on a plate and set the plate over a bowl of hot water until the butter softens.
